该命令中的-C dir参数,将tar的工作目录从当前目录改为/home/usr2,将file2文件(不带绝对路径)压缩到file2.tar中。注意:-C dir参数的作用在于改变工作目录,其有效期为该命令中下一次-C dir参数之前。 使用tar的-C dir参数,同样可以做到在当前目录/home/usr1下将文件解压缩到其他目录,例如: $ tar -xvf fil...
如果您经常使用命令行,您将习惯于使用 cd 导航目录。您可能也习惯于在两个目录之间切换,来回在一个目录中运行命令,在另一个目录中检查文件等等。也许您甚至 使用历史命令来重复自己。 到现在,您应该不会惊讶于得知有更好的方法。 cd 存在几个秘密,不过其中最有用的快捷方式之一是“cd -”这种形式: 每次运行“c...
4. 文件路径问题:当你使用tar命令时,确保你指定的文件或目录路径是正确的。如果文件或目录不存在,tar命令将无法正常工作。 5. 命令语法错误:最后,如果你在使用tar命令时遇到错误,可能是因为命令的语法不正确。请确保你按照正确的格式和选项使用tar命令。你可以使用以下命令来获取tar命令的帮助信息: “` tar –help...
排除多个文件和目录 要排除多个文件和目录,可以使用多个 --exclude。比如,我们将要排除文件 Bash.sh 和 子目录 Sub-Directory-1,使用如下命令: 复制 tar--exclude='Bash.sh'--exclude='Sub-Directory-1'-zcvfNoDir.tar.gz . 1. 但是如果要排除的文件很多,那么这个命令会变得很长。。。如果它...
4) 使用gzip命令压缩1.txt文件名为1.txt.gz gzip 1.txt 5) 解压缩1.txt.gz gunzip 1.txt.gz 6) 使用bzip2压缩1.txt压缩后文件名为1.txt.bz2 bzip2 1.txt 7) 解压缩1.txt.bz2 bunzip2 1.txt.bz2 8) 解包1.tar,解包后文件存放到/tmp目录下 ...
tar是 Linux 系统中一个非常强大的文件打包和解压工具。它支持多种压缩格式,如 gzip、bzip2 和 xz 等。下面是关于tar命令解压的一些基础概念、优势、类型、应用场景以及常见问题的解答。 基础概念 tar命令主要用于将多个文件和目录打包成一个文件,同时也支持从这个打包文件中解压出原始的文件和目录。它通常与其他压缩...
与前面的gzip命令不同,通过tar压缩后是保留原文件或原目录的。 二、将 .tar.gz 文件解压:tar -zxf ①、命令名称:tar ②、英文原意: ③、命令所在路径:/bin/tar ④、执行权限:所有用户 ⑤、功能描述:将格式为.tar.gz的压缩文件解压 ⑥、语法:tar 选项【-zxf】【.tar.gz的压缩文件名】【指定解压后的文件...
简单易用:tar 命令的语法简单,使用方便。 使用示例: 代码语言:javascript 复制 # 打包文件和目录 tar-cvf archive.tar file1 file2 dir1 # 解包 tar-xvf archive.tar 2. gzip gzip是一种常用的 Linux 压缩工具,它可以将单个文件进行压缩。gzip 压缩后的文件以.gz扩展名结尾。它的特点包括: ...
使用tar命令在Linux中加密文件可以通过两种方式实现:使用gzip压缩的同时加密,或者使用加密选项。 1. 使用gzip压缩的同时加密: “` tar cz file1 file2 | openssl enc -e -aes256 -out archive.tar.gz.enc “` –cz:创建tar压缩文件并使用gzip压缩。
tar命令是linux非常使用频率非常高的一个命令,比如:离线软件包的解压缩、将一个目录打包备份、将一个压缩包解压到一个指定的目录。tar命令主要用来将一个或者多个目录以及一个或者多个文件打包到一个以后缀为tar的文件里,同时也可以将归档的文件压缩成以tar.gz结尾的文件。可以将一个tar或者tar.gz结尾的文件解压...